## Relevance tuning

Notes for the weekly sync. Fieldspar's ranker now blends BM25 with the
click-prior model from the Norbeck experiment. Title boost was cut after
the keyword-stuffing incident; recency decay is steeper for news-type
docs only. Do not change weights mid-week — the A/B harness assumes a
stable baseline. Any edit needs a rerun of the offline eval suite. The
active constants are:

tuning table, yajog-yahof:
BUDGETS = {
    "lamvan": 303,
    "wenox": 460,
    "fenvan": 525,
}

# Basement Archive Room — Night Access

The archive room under Pellworth House holds old contracts and the tape backups. Night shift: take stairwell C, not the lift (it's switched off after midnight). Lights are on a timer by the door — slap the button as you go in. Sign the logbook, even at 3am, yes really. The keypad by the door takes the code below.

staff pass of fahap-tajeg = bdg-FT-6

- [ ] Verify the Granview diff viewer streams files above 500 MB without loading them fully into memory. Open the synthetic 2 GB fixture, confirm scroll position stays stable during hunk navigation, and check that the side-by-side toggle does not re-fetch. Sign off only after the memory profile stays flat. The candidate build's trace token follows below.

trace token, tawep-fahif: htk3_b58